When it comes to insulation materials, EPS 150 insulation stands out as a popular choice for many homeowners and builders Expanded polystyrene (EPS) is a lightweight, rigid plastic foam insulation material that has been used for decades to provide excellent thermal performance EPS 150, in particular, is a type of EPS insulation that offers a high compressive strength of 150 kPa, making it suitable for a wide range of applications In this article, we will explore the benefits of EPS 150 insulation and why it is a great option for your next construction project.
One of the primary benefits of EPS 150 insulation is its excellent thermal performance By effectively reducing heat transfer, EPS 150 helps to keep your home warm in the winter and cool in the summer This can lead to significant energy savings by reducing the need for heating and cooling systems to work harder to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ature Additionally, EPS 150 insulation can help to create a more consistent temperature throughout your home, eliminating cold spots and drafts that can make living spaces uncomfortable.
Another advantage of EPS 150 insulation is its high compressive strength With a compressive strength of 150 kPa, EPS 150 can support heavy loads without deforming or losing its insulating properties This makes it ideal for applications such as under slab insulation, where the insulation material must withstand the weight of a concrete floor or pavement above it By using EPS 150 insulation in these high-load applications, you can ensure that your insulation will remain effective and durable for years to come.
